Glass Fiber Fabric-Faced Nano Microporous Insulation Board
Product Description:
Glass Fiber Fabric-Faced Nano Microporous Insulation Board is a nano microporous thermal insulation board with high-temperature-resistant glass fiber fabric laminated on the surface of the standard nano microporous board, which shows excellent thermal insulation performance at high temperature. The high-temperature resistant glass fiber cloth increases the strength of the nano-board, and almost no dust can be realized during construction and taking. This product has very good cutting characteristics and is easy to be cut by tools such as knives and saws. Glass fiber fabric-faced nano microporous insulation board can be fixed by glue or anchor. This material has advanced technology, high economic benefit and excellent flame retardant performance. Customers can customize the thickness of 5-50mm according to the use situation.

Why Engineers Choose Glass Fiber Fabric-Faced Microporous Insulation
Glass fiber fabric-faced nano microporous insulation board is our most mechanically robust high temperature insulation panel — an E-glass or S-glass woven fabric covers both faces of the fumed silica microporous core.
The fabric skin tolerates vibration, abrasive dust, and incidental foot traffic that would tear aluminum foil or PE film — extending service life of the microporous thermal insulation in petrochemical, marine, and mobile equipment.
Specifying this microporous insulation panel for pipework carrying thermal cycling or rotating equipment housings gives maintenance teams a skin that can be wiped clean and inspected between outages.
